_учебник_ Журавлев Ю.И. Распознавание. Математические методы. Программная система. Практические применения (2005) (_учебник_ Журавлев Ю.И. Распознавание. Математические методы. Программная система. Практические применения (2005).pdf), страница 27
Описание файла
PDF-файл из архива "_учебник_ Журавлев Ю.И. Распознавание. Математические методы. Программная система. Практические применения (2005).pdf", который расположен в категории "". Всё это находится в предмете "(ммо) методы машинного обучения" из 10 семестр (2 семестр магистратуры), которые можно найти в файловом архиве МГУ им. Ломоносова. Не смотря на прямую связь этого архива с МГУ им. Ломоносова, его также можно найти и в других разделах. .
Просмотр PDF-файла онлайн
Текст 27 страницы из PDF
рис. 32):129Рис. 32. Выбор загрузчика.Tab reader загружает файлы формата программы LOREG /6/, Simple readerзагружает текстовые файлы, содержащие выборки, значения которых разделены «,».ODBC загружает большинство стандартных типов файлов, в том числе Excel файлы.В случае выбора «Tab reader» или «Simple reader» на экране появится стандартныйдиалог загрузки файлов, а в случае выбора ODBC - диалог, который позволяет указыватьразличные параметры загрузки из соответствующих файлов. Более подробно загрузчики исоответствующие форматы файлов будут описаны ниже.Загрузить выборку для обучения коллективных методов.Методы построения коллективных решений могут требовать отдельной выборкидля обучения.
В случае ее отсутствия можно просто загрузить выборку, котораяиспользовалась для обучения методов коллектива. В остальном процесс загрузкипроисходит так же, как и в предыдущем пункте. Данный пункт меню доступен только вслучае проектов для распознавания.Загрузить распознаваемую выборку.Загрузка выборки для распознавания. Процесс загрузки аналогичен описанномувыше. Данный пункт меню, естественно, доступен только для распознавания.Добавить в проект.При выборе данного пункта на экране появится подменю, позволяющее добавить впроект либо обычный метод, либо метод построения коллективного решения. Послевыбора соответствующего типа метода на экране появится диалог со списком имеющихсяв наличие методов соответствующего типа (см.
рис. 33):130Рис. 33. Добавление метода.Удалить из проекта.При выборе данного пункта меню на экране появится подменю, описанное в предыдущемпункте. При выборе соответствующего типа метода на экран будет выведен диалог ссодержащимися на данный момент в проекте методами (см. рис. 34):Рис.
34. Удаление метода.5.1.2.3. Пункт меню «Опции».Состоит из единственного пункта, который выводит на экран диалог с опциямипрограммы (см. рис. 35):Рис. 35. Настройка отчетаПереключатель«Создаватьотчетвтекстовомформате»позволяетвключить/отключить создание отчета в текстовом виде. При работе программы131результаты обучения и распознавания всегда представляются в виде HTML документа.Данная опция позволяет наравне с этим документом создавать такой же отчет еще и ввиде текстового файла. Вывод большой таблицы оценок на экран в HTML формате можетпотребоватьзначительноговремени,поэтомупредоставляетсявозможностьвключения/отключения вывода таблицы оценок, или вывод таблицы оценок, если онаменьше определенного размера.5.1.2.4.
Пункт меню «Окна».ЯвляетсястандартнымпунктомменюмногодокументальногоприложенияWindows. Позволяет переключаться между окнами различных проектов и распределять ихвнутри главного окна программы различным образом.5.1.2.5. Пункт меню «Помощь».Состоит из двух пунктов: «Помощь», «О программе».Помощь.Выводит на экран окно, которое содержит в себе описание программы в видегипертекста.О программе.Выводит на экран диалог с информацией о разработчиках данного программногопродукта.5.1.3.
Окно проекта.Основная обработка данных происходит в рамках проекта системы. Каждый проектсодержит некоторый набор методов соответствующего типа из предоставляемыхсистемой. В рамках проекта обрабатывается одна и та же выборка данных всемивключенными в проект методами.5.1.3.1. Окно проекта (эксперт).Окна проектов для распознавания и кластеризации в случае экспертногопользователя выглядят схожим образом. Отличие заключается в закладках в правой частиэкрана. Данные закладки управляют различными этапами обработки информации,которые у методов распознавания и кластеризации различны. Описание каждой закладкибудет дано ниже.Основное окно проекта выглядит следующим образом (см. рис. 36):132Рис.
36. Основное окно проектаВ левой части окна отображается дерево методов проекта. С его помощью можнопереключаться между разными методами и между этапами работы одного метода. Деревоимеет следующую структуру. Корнем дерева является проект, который определяетсясвоим названием. На следующем уровне находятся методы. В случае, если в проектдобавлено несколько одинаковых методов (это может быть сделано с целью сравнитьрезультаты, даваемые методом при различных параметрах), то к названию методов будутдобавлены номера (1), (2),... Вершины, отходящие от каждого метода, соответствуютуправляющим закладкам с таким же названием.В правой части окна содержатся управляющие закладки, каждая из которыхозначает некоторый этап работы метода.
Более подробно об этом написано ниже приописании управления методами.В нижней части окна находится поле, в которое выводятся различные сообщения,возникающие при работе методов. При каждом старте процесса обучения илираспознавания данное окно будет автоматически очищаться.5.1.3.2. Окно проекта (пользователь)В данной версии программы проект для обычного пользователя реализован толькодля задачи распознавания.
В отличие от экспертного случая, в таком проектепользователю не предоставляется возможность непосредственного управления методами.Вместо этого ему предлагаются несколько готовых сценариев обучения. В соответствии свыбранным сценарием будет производиться индивидуальная настройка каждого метода и133применяться различные средства контроля качества обучения. Окно проекта выглядитследующим образом (см. рис. 37):Рис. 37. Окно проекта (пользователь).Окно состоит из двух частей. В нижнюю часть выводятся различные сообщения,которые возникают при работе методов, а в верхней находятся управляющие закладки.Для данного типа проекта можно загрузить только выборку для обучения. Распознаваниев таком проекте производится для конкретного объекта, который задается вручную.Оценивание точности распознавания каждым алгоритмом осуществляется автоматическипо обучающим данным.
Опишем управляющие закладки данного проекта.Закладка «Выборка».На данной закладке отображается обучающая выборка. Система предоставляетразличные возможности по отображению выборки, которые будут описаны ниже.Закладка «Информация о признаках».Закладка выглядит следующим образом (см. рис. 38):134Рис. 38. Информация о признаках.В текущей версии на закладке отображены для каждого признака его минимальное,максимальное и среднее значения.Закладка «Обучение».Закладка выглядит следующим образом (см. рис.
39):135Рис. 39. ОбучениеЛевый столбец выводит список всех доступных сценариев обучения и средствконтроля качества. Пользователь должен выбрать один сценарий из списка. В следующемстолбце выведены все доступные для обучения методы, пользователь должен отметить теметоды, которые он хочет использовать для обработки заданной выборки. После этого оннажимает на кнопку «Начать обучение». По мере обучения методов на экране будутотображаться получаемые оценки качества обучения.
После того как все методы обучены,пользователь переходит к следующей закладке.Закладка «Распознавание».136Рис. 40. Вид закладки «Распознавание»На данном этапе работы пользователю предлагается задать значения признаковраспознаваемого элемента. Те значения, которые не заданы, будут обрабатываться какнеизвестные. После нажатия на кнопку «Распознать» произойдет распознавание заданногоэлемента всеми обученными ранее методами.5.1.4. Метод распознавания (эксперт).Опишем закладки, посредством которых управляются методы распознавания в режимеэксперт.Закладка «О методе».Закладка выглядит следующим образом (см. рис. 41):137Рис.
41. Вид закладки «О методе»На ней выводится краткая информация о методе: название, версия и описание метода «водну строку».Закладка «Исходная выборка».На данной закладке отображается выборка, которая была загружена для обучения.Выглядит закладка следующим образом (см. рис. 42):138Рис. 42. Вид закладки «Исходная выборка»В системе предусмотрены различные режимы отображения выборки, по умолчаниювыборка проецируется на плоскость признаков №1, 2. Объекты одного цвета относятся кодному классу. Признаки, на плоскость которых отображается выборка, можно выбрать изсоответствующих«выпадающихсписков».Всписке«Проекциявыборкина»предусмотрено три режима проекций: первый – проекция на два заданных признака,второй – проекция на один выбранный признак (выводится гистограмма значенийпризнака), третья – проекция на плоскость двух обобщенных признаков.
При нажатии направую кнопку мыши на экране появится выпадающее меню, состоящие из двух пунктов.При выборе первого из них на экране появиться следующий диалог (см. рис. 43):Рис. 43. Изображение выборкиВ данном диалоге можно выбрать следующие параметры изображения выборки:отображение объектов точками или номерами, размер точки/номера, число интерваловразбиения значений признака. Последний параметр используется при построениипроекции выборки на один признак.При выборе второго пункта меню на экране появится следующий диалог (см. рис.